Lippert-Patrick Merger Talks

Lippert Components and Patrick Industries, two of the RV industry's largest suppliers, are in early talks for a merger, announced via identical press releases late Friday after markets closed. Lippert makes chassis, axles, brakes, leveling systems, cabinetry, and appliances branded with its name. Patrick, the larger firm with a $3.5 billion market cap compared to Lippert's $3 billion, owns 86 brands supplying RV furniture, panels, fiberglass caps, sinks, fittings, lumber, and even RV transport services—extending into marine and housing sectors.

What you'll learn

  • 1 (00:31) **Episode Teaser** - Hosts preview Lippert-Patrick merger talks and KOA 2026 camping report showing RV and family camping declines
  • 2 (01:20) **Severe Weather Warnings** - Discussion on spring storms, shifting Tornado Alley, and RV safety tips like storm shelters and wind avoidance
  • 3 (06:22) **Lippert-Patrick Merger Talks** - Two major RV component suppliers in advanced merger discussions post-markets Friday
  • 4 (12:42) **Merger Implications** - Potential for cheaper parts but lower quality passed to consumers; companies defend records amid chassis issues
  • 5 (17:21) **KOA 2026 Camping Report Overview** - Annual third-party survey of 4,000+ US households reveals post-COVID reversals in participation and demographics
  • 6 (19:23) **Demographic Shifts** - Gen Z camping plummets (22% to 13%), millennials slight drop; boomers and Gen X rise as new/steady owners
  • 7 (28:04) **Family and Diversity Declines** - Camping families with kids drop to 43% (lowest in 10 years); non-white households back to 30%, same-sex to 9%

Show Notes

In this episode of the RV Miles Podcast, Jason and Abby discuss severe spring storms and the importance of weather awareness for RVers, especially around tornadoes and high winds. They break down reports that major RV component manufacturers Lippert Components and Patrick Industries are in talks for a merger, and how that could further consolidate the supply chain and reduce competition across RV construction and delivery. They also review KOA’s 2026 camping report, highlighting declines in frequent camping, Gen Z participation, and camping families with kids, alongside increasing costs and shifting demographics.
